.titlestyle258766{ line-height: 220%; color: #222222; font-size: 9pt; font-weight: bold; text-decoration: none;}
.summarystyle258766{ line-height: 150%; color: #222222; font-size: 9pt;}

.morestyle259171{ font-size: 9pt ;}
.clickstyle259171{ font-size: 9pt; color: #222222; line-height: 150% ;}
.leaderfont259171{ font-size: 9pt; line-height: 150% ;}
.titlestyle259171{ line-height: 150%; font-size: 12pt; text-decoration: none;}
.columnstyle259171{ font-size: 9pt; color: #222222; text-decoration: none ;}
.timestyle259171{ font-size: 9pt; color: #222222; line-height: 150%;}
A.c259171 {
line-height: 150%; font-size: 12pt; text-decoration: none;}
A.c259171:link {
color:#222222;}
A.c259171:visited {
color:#222222;}
A.c259171:active {
color: #222222;}
A.c259171:hover {
color: #cc0000;}
.morestyle258765{ font-size: 9pt ;}
.clickstyle258765{ font-size: 9pt; color: #222222; line-height: 150% ;}
.leaderfont258765{ font-size: 9pt; line-height: 150% ;}
.titlestyle258765{ line-height: 150%; font-size: 12pt; text-decoration: none;}
.columnstyle258765{ font-size: 9pt; color: #222222; text-decoration: none ;}
.timestyle258765{ font-size: 9pt; color: #222222; line-height: 150%;}
A.c258765 {
line-height: 150%; font-size: 12pt; text-decoration: none;}
A.c258765:link {
color:#222222;}
A.c258765:visited {
color:#222222;}
A.c258765:active {
color: #222222;}
A.c258765:hover {
color: #cc0000;}
.titlestyle259104{ font-family: 宋体; font-size: 12pt; color: #222222; text-align: center; padding-top: 0px;}

.morestyle259172{ font-size: 9pt ;}
.clickstyle259172{ font-size: 9pt; color: #222222; line-height: 150% ;}
.leaderfont259172{ font-size: 9pt; line-height: 150% ;}
.titlestyle259172{ line-height: 150%; font-size: 12pt; text-decoration: none;}
.columnstyle259172{ font-size: 9pt; color: #222222; text-decoration: none ;}
.timestyle259172{ font-size: 9pt; color: #222222; line-height: 150%;}
A.c259172 {
line-height: 150%; font-size: 12pt; text-decoration: none;}
A.c259172:link {
color:#222222;}
A.c259172:visited {
color:#222222;}
A.c259172:active {
color: #222222;}
A.c259172:hover {
color: #cc0000;}
.morestyle259173{ font-size: 9pt ;}
.clickstyle259173{ font-size: 9pt; color: #222222; line-height: 150% ;}
.leaderfont259173{ font-size: 9pt; line-height: 150% ;}
.titlestyle259173{ line-height: 150%; font-size: 12pt; text-decoration: none;}
.columnstyle259173{ font-size: 9pt; color: #222222; text-decoration: none ;}
.timestyle259173{ font-size: 9pt; color: #222222; line-height: 150%;}
A.c259173 {
line-height: 150%; font-size: 12pt; text-decoration: none;}
A.c259173:link {
color:#222222;}
A.c259173:visited {
color:#222222;}
A.c259173:active {
color: #222222;}
A.c259173:hover {
color: #cc0000;}
.titlestyle259177{ font-size: 9pt; color: #222222; line-height: 200%; text-decoration: none ;}

